Face the Cat in today’s 8th at Gulfstream won a N1x for 3Yo’s going a one turn mile and looked well doing it. This horse debuted on the turf at Ellis Park and ran an even 6th. He showed back up at Gulfstream on Jan. 4 and won a MSW by 1 length in good time earning a Beyer of 81. Today, he set the pace two wide and drew off to win by about 3 or 4 in decent time, 1.35.xx, I believe. The field included the well thought of Zito duo Stevil and Web Gem, as well as Mythical Pegasus, who has hit the board in graded races, and Nistle’s Crunch, who was coming off a 3rd in a turf stakes. By Tale of the Cat out of a Forty Niner Mare, the distance shouldn’t be a problem. Trained by Helen Pitts and ridden in his last two by Prado, he is atleast on my radar.

Lots of interesting races Saturday, both with  thoroughbreds and harness racing. Most of it concentrated at the Gulfstream and Santa Anita.

 First off at Gulfstream Park, in race 6 the Robert LaPenta owned, Farish bred, Nick Zito trained Cool Coal Man stamped himself as a legit Kentucky Derby contender after winning a N2x for 3Yo going 1m 1/8th. He didn’t do it in very fast fashion, and the Beyer will probably only be 78-84 range at a quick glance. I like the fact that he settled off a very solid pace after being headstrong in a graded stakes debut. He also finished well enough going that distance after being off since November. Zito has to be happy with this  effort as it forms a perfect foundation to build upon this spring.
